Understanding Tire Specifications
Knowing the numbers on your tires is essential. Here’s a breakdown of what those tire sizes mean:
- 255/55R19: The first number (255) is the width of the tire in millimeters. The second number (55) is the aspect ratio, which shows the height of the tire’s sidewall as a percentage of the width. The ‘R’ indicates that it’s a radial tire, and the last number (19) is the diameter of the wheel in inches.
- 275/50R20: This tire is slightly wider, which can improve grip and stability. The aspect ratio is lower, meaning a shorter sidewall, which can enhance handling but may result in a harsher ride.
- 275/45R21: This is the widest option available for the Q8, providing the best grip but also the least amount of sidewall cushioning. It’s great for performance but can be less forgiving on rough roads.

Maintaining Your Tires
Proper maintenance is key to getting the most out of your tires. Here are some tips:
- Regularly check tire pressure. Under-inflated tires can lead to poor handling and increased wear.
- Rotate your tires every 5,000 to 7,500 miles to ensure even wear.
- Inspect for tread wear and replace tires when the tread depth gets below 2/32 of an inch.
